| FORTY-FIVE-YEAR-OLD
school principal Judith de Verteuil is a very striking individual;
once you see, meet or talk with her, you will never forget the experience.
Some lives may be forever altered as a result for the engagement.
Dressed in a long-flowing white gown, with a tiara on her head,
elbow-length gloves and her neatly coiffure hair held back with
a ponytail holder, the beauty queen-like Missionary Mannequin completes
her appearance with a blue wrist corsage, earrings and a sash that
proclaims “Jesus is Lord” on the front and a scripture
verse on the reverse.
Beginning in 2001, de Verteuil, of Maraval, has been taking her
unique missionary work to the streets of Trinidad and Tobago.
She has been seen in Port of Spain, St. James, Curepe and Tunapuna
... among other local areas.

The cocoa-coloured Missionary Mannequin beauty has also travelled
to other Caribbean islands such as Barbados and St. Maarten.
Attached to the Holiness Revival Ministries of French Street, Woodbrook,
the Lord’s servant de Verteuil, principal of the Paideuo Learning
Centre, St. Paul Street, East Dry River, Port of Spain, spends her
days attending to the needs of at risk, special education need students.
Then she hits the streets!
|
Sister Judith,
as she is known to many friends and fellow faithful, told
TnT Mirror that her objective is “To draw and hold the
attention of the public”.
She prays before, due and after her marathon of the Lord’s
work.
Standing two to three hours in a stationary, mime-like position,
Judith draws constant stares from pedestrians and motorists
alike.
Time permitting, she engages in her unique missionary work
three to four days each week.
Seemingly in a catatonic state, the Missionary Mannequin is
in constant awareness of her surroundings.
She sees the parade of personality, which parades pass her.

She hears the comments directed towards her. And she prays at all
times!
At any given moment, she will break her stance and engage in conversation
with those that so desire.
And then it’s back to work.
Asked what type of reaction her presence has on the crowds that
she encounters, she said: “I evoke different responses, from
different people.”
And Sister Judith is not afraid of ridicule. She is above that,
after all, she added: “There is no ridicule in the Lord’s
work.”
A US evangelist Pat Robertson’s 700-Club affiliate, group
trained the school principal in mime, dance and drama, in 1995.
The group has trained others, like Sister Judith, in other locations
to use the disciplines “as a tool for street ministry”.
The multi-talented and sunny Missionary Mannequin is also a trained
music teacher and prepares local music students for their music
examinations with Trinity College of Music, London, England.
Sister Judith de Verteuil, the school principal, music teacher and
Missionary Mannequin has only one message for Trinidad and Tobago:
“When the heart of man is turned towards God, we will see
a change in the nation.” |
